There are several reasons why weed treatment is necessary. Firstly, weeds can detract from the appearance of businesses and homes, giving an impression of neglect. They also create habitats for pests such as insects and rodents, requiring additional pest control measures. In industrial settings, dry weeds near buildings can increase the risk of fires, and larger weed species can damage infrastructure like roads and pavements. Moreover, weeds can reduce the density of lawns and spoil their aesthetic appeal.
